Kahler Berg
Kahler Berg is a peak in Dolgen am See, Rostock, Mecklenburg-Western Pomerania and has an elevation of 36 metres. Kahler Berg is situated nearby to the village Groß Lantow, as well as near the hamlet Mückendorf.Places of Interest
